Oil Prices Resume Gains

WTI crude oil futures climbed to approximately $72.1 per barrel on Tuesday, heightened by Israel's commitment to intensify strikes on Iran, thereby increasing concerns over a possible escalation that could disrupt energy supplies and key trade routes. On Monday, U.S. President Donald Trump urged for the evacuation of Tehran following Israel's intensified aerial bombardments on the Iranian capital, targeting sites such as state media offices. These developments emerged even as reports signaled Iran's urgent call for de-escalation and a return to negotiations regarding its nuclear agenda. This news somewhat alleviated fears surrounding the conflict, contributing to a highly volatile trading session on Monday, where oil prices fluctuated within an $8 range before settling lower. Concurrently, market participants are also contending with the anticipated imposition of new tariffs by President Trump in the upcoming weeks and the swift increase in production quotas by OPEC+, both of which stand to considerably affect the oil market.
